Rosehill Farm Bed Breakfast photoWhen you stay in Wales visit our lovely Welsh farmhouse for Bed and Breakfast for a wonderful and unique Pembrokeshire holiday or short break. You may wish to relax and enjoy the beautiful beaches the nearest being only about 5 miles away coastline and the River Cleddau. For a more active time indulge in the numerous outdoor activities or savour the rich history of Pembrokeshire through its castles and historic towns. What ever your interests base yourselves at Rosehill. We are located centrally for visiting both North and South Pembrokeshire in an attractive and tranquil farmland setting with sheep cattle and poultry.Our farmhouse has three comfortable double rooms two ensuite and one with a private bathroom with a bath next door. The breakfast room is also used as a lounge with television. All our rooms have a hospitality tray for teacoffee and fresh milk etc TVDVD and clock radio with countryside views. For breakfasts I offer mainly local produce for a good selection of traditional cooked breakfasts omelatesor pancakes or lighter choices such as chopped fruit and yoghurt. A packed lunch can be arranged with prior notice. I normally use eggs from our own chickens our own sausages and my homemade bread. Vegetarian and special diets are catered for with prior notice. Some light refreshments eg Tea and cakes are offered between 4.30 and 6pm upon first arrival at Rosehill.We have many beautiful beaches a few miles away as well as the famous Pembrokeshire Coastal Path. The Brunel Cycle Path is down our lane.We are not too far from the departure point for Skomer Island where the puffins breed in spring and early summer. Our home is central to many attractions for the wildlife and countryside enthusiasts those who want to explore our history and castles and those wishing to do activities such as coastal walking bird watching sailing fishinggolf riding and many more things. Rosehill farm is close to historic towns Haverfordwest Milford Haven and Neyland and their Marinas and Pembroke and its Castle. The wonderful St David's Cathedral is not far away.

Hotel directions :
From the M4 motorway (junction 49) take the A48 signed to Carmarthen.From Carmarthen take the A40 signed to Haverfordwest.At Haverfordwest follow signs for Milford Haven (A4076). From Merlins Bridge Johnston is about two and a half miles away. Once you are in Johnston go just past the Fish and Chip shop on your left and take Church Road which is the next on your left.At the corner on your left will be a small Norman Church called St Peter's and on your right will be the doctor's surgery.Follow Church Road for 100 metres then turn left which is signed to Rosemarket.Follow this road going over the small railway bridge.Rosehill Farm will be on your right about mile further down this road midway between Johnston and Rosemarket.
